Output 1068af14e2512875dc38e3371ef36f071ff040cd8b9e628fab8107cd1ba43656:0

value
1004690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65071d93234589a82300fda09e3b21a8ecda9847 OP_EQUAL
address
3AuChKAmydwZ7DpRMM67J2AaS8qd5nckbW
transaction
1068af14e2512875dc38e3371ef36f071ff040cd8b9e628fab8107cd1ba43656
confirmations
342086
spent
true